1. Simplifies the Recruitment Process

Recruiting involves multiple steps — job postings, resume screening, interview coordination, and candidate communication. Managing all of these manually can be overwhelming, especially when dealing with dozens or hundreds of applicants.

An Applicant Tracking System centralizes all recruitment activities in one platform. With Exelare, recruiters can manage job listings, track applicants, and monitor progress at every stage — from sourcing to onboarding — without switching between multiple tools.

This level of organization and automation saves time, reduces human error, and ensures a smoother hiring experience for both recruiters and candidates.


2. Saves Valuable Time with Automation

Time is one of the most valuable resources in recruitment. Traditional methods often involve repetitive administrative tasks like sorting resumes, sending emails, or updating spreadsheets.

An Applicant Tracking System automates these processes. Exelare’s ATS can parse resumes, rank candidates based on qualifications, and automatically send notifications or reminders. This automation allows recruiters to focus on what truly matters — building relationships and assessing top talent.

6. Enables Data-Driven Recruitment Decisions

Data is the new currency of effective recruitment. An Applicant Tracking System captures and analyzes valuable information throughout the hiring process, helping recruiters make smarter decisions.

Exelare’s ATS provides detailed analytics on key metrics such as:

  • Time-to-hire
  • Source of hire
  • Conversion rates
  • Candidate pipeline performance

These insights allow recruiters to identify bottlenecks, measure success, and continuously improve their strategies. With data-driven decision-making, recruitment becomes more strategic, predictable, and successful.
